Handle unread-command-events consistently (bug#23980)

* src/keyboard.c (read_char): Events put into `unread-command-events'
with the form (t . EVENT) should always have the t stripped when read
out.
* test/src/keyboard-tests.el: New tests for `unread-command-events'.

(require 'ert)
(ert-deftest keyboard-unread-command-events ()
"Test `unread-command-events'."
(should (equal (progn (push ?\C-a unread-command-events)
(read-event nil nil 1))
?\C-a))
(should (equal (progn (run-with-timer
1 nil
(lambda () (push '(t . ?\C-b) unread-command-events)))
(read-event nil nil 2))
?\C-b)))
